What does SSS stand for in triangle congruence?

Back

SSS stands for Side-Side-Side, a theorem stating that if three sides of one triangle are equal to three sides of another triangle, the triangles are congruent.

What does SAS stand for in triangle congruence?

Back

SAS stands for Side-Angle-Side, a theorem stating that if two sides and the included angle of one triangle are equal to two sides and the included angle of another triangle, the triangles are congruent.
